The architecture of a building is never understood by a single façade, but through the way every element responds to its climate, culture and history. The Aitchison College Old building proves this with every detailed arch, dome, and carving.
Following an asymmetrical plan quite unlike other notable works by Bhai Ram Singh, the building is an expression of the architectural hybridity that defined colonial-era Punjab, bringing together British planning with Indian, Mughal and Sikh influences.

A central double heighted hall opens up to classrooms on either side, kept cool in the heat of Lahore with verandas encompassing the entire perimeter, and terracotta jallis placed at strategic openings. Not only do both these elements stimulate ventilation, they also add another layer for the light to filter through, changing how the space feels with the passing seasons.

Inside, the exceptionally high ceilings further air flow by allowing hot air to rise and escape through clerestory windows, pulling cooler wind into the lower levels. Before mechanical cooling, these were passive environmental strategies built directly into the architecture. However, with rising global temperatures, the recent restoration had to reconcile these original strategies with contemporary requirements in order to make the space habitable once again.
Air-conditioning was necessary, but visible outdoor units would have disrupted the building’s historic appearance. Instead, the units were concealed within the surrounding shrubbery, with their pipes carefully routed beneath the road encircling the building.

The inside units too, were cleverly concealed behind what appear to be decorative jallis.
Similarly, despite the multitude of windows providing ample daylight, in an era when space usage is not dictated by the positioning of the sun, artificial lighting was an inevitable addition.

However, incorporating it without hindering the authenticity of the space meant finding ways to light up the space from within. The solution was recessed lighting wherever possible.
Though seemingly chosen for beauty at first glance, material plays just as vital a role in the functionality of a building. In this case, Jodhpur marble, brick and terracotta create a palette that is both tactile and climatically appropriate.
Thick brick walls, paired with lime plaster finish and cool terracotta flooring ensures no heat is trapped in the space, once again proving the effect of working with the environment instead.

As the region did not experience frequent earthquakes of high magnitude, the original design of the building was not made to withstand large earthquakes. However, years of weathering and unforeseen circumstances later, measures had to be taken to prevent the structure from falling apart.
Therefore, metal braces on the outer walls and banisters supporting the original terracotta ones were necessary interventions to keep the original building intact.

The Aitchison College Old Buidling is a prime example of the impact every detail, from material to window positioning, has on the experience of a space. Ultimately, the Raees Faheem Associates’ restoration succeeds because it does not attempt to make the Old Building look new. It allows its age, materials and accumulated layers to remain legible while quietly correcting what time has damaged.
